| Objective:To compare of hyperlipidemia efficacy and liver function with Catgut embedding and simply taking Atorvastatin Calcium Tablets orally; Comparison of treatment efficacy, serum low-density lipoprotein cholesterol(LDL-C), alanine aminotransferase (ALT), aspartate aminotransferase(AST) and body mass index(BMI) between these two treatments of hyperlipidemia after the same course of treatment.Methods:Cases were collected and selected from Hospital, Chinese medicine and endocrinology physiotherapy clinic which met the inclusion and exclusion criteria for patients with hyperlipidemia and 60 cases were selected.60 cases were randomly divided into treatment group and control group with 30 cases in each group. The treatment group was treated with catgut embedding and the control group simply took atorvastatin calcium tablets orally. Treatment group acupoint selected Zhongwan, Tianshu(double), Fenglong(double), Zusanli(double), Yinlingquan (double), and was treated by Catgut embedding once every 2 weeks. Total treatment course included four times which lasted 8 weeks. The control group simply took atorvastatin orally 1 piece (20 mg) each time and took it 1 time a day, half an hour after supper with the warm boiling water, which lasted 8 weeks. We recorded values of serum LDL-C, ALT, AST, and BMI before and after treatment, analyzed statistical data, and compared the efficacy and liver function between two groups.Results:1. After treatment, the LDL-C values of treatment group and control group are significantly lower than values that were before treatment which existed a significant difference(P<0.01). The differences of LDL-C values between two groups which were after treatment were insignificant which showed no significant difference(P>0.05).2. After treatment, the LDL-C values of treatment group significantly decreased which is a lot more than control group in borderline high LDL-C patients, which was a significant difference(P<0.05). The LDL-C values of control group decreased more than that of treatment group in high LDL-C patients, which was a significant difference (P<0.05).3. After treatment, BMI values of treatment group were significantly lower than values that were before treatment which revealed a significant difference(P<0.01). BMI have no obvious changes before and after the treatment of control group which demonstrated no significant difference(P>0.05). The BMI values of treatment group than control group significantly decreased, which revealed a significant difference(P<0.01).4. The ALT and AST level of treatment group was not significantly changed before and after treatment which showed no significant difference(P>0.05). The AST level of control group were not significantly changed before and after treatment which showed no significant difference(P>0.05), while the serum ALT level of control group was significantly increased after treatment which was a significant difference(P<0.05). After treatment, the ALT levels of control group was higher than treatment group which suggested a significant difference(P<0.05); the AST levels between these two groups did not show obvious differences which demonstrated no significant difference(P>0.05).Conclusion:The LDL-C values of Catgut embedding therapy are lower than values that were before treatment, and the curative effect is better than that of atorvastatin calcium tablet. Catgut embedding therapy had no significant effect on serum ALT, AST levels. However, catgut embedding therapy is better in improving BMI than taking atorvastatin tablets orally. Further more, the security of catgut embedding therapy is good and worth clinical application. |
